Output eca4152d875831abedb3ec37d97764a125935f762f85fb1e926da2aad9dc6d62:4

value
70900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b15420adac06055a5c6ffe398c8d1ea1b198464 OP_EQUALVERIFY OP_CHECKSIG
address
16PQLMCNmWQWtTGuBZBQDnDrx165SkUVhz
transaction
eca4152d875831abedb3ec37d97764a125935f762f85fb1e926da2aad9dc6d62
spent
true